have a Aussie Harlequin tusk who ive had for about 8 months, always been a pig and ate anything i threw in tank. recently it almost seems like he is loosing his vision, he tries to catch food when i feed but just cant seem to get it, if it settles on the bottom hes able to suck it up but thats it. All other fish are eating and acting normally, no aggression issues that i have seen. I QT all my fish with copper and prazi pro

tank is 6' 150g with a 150g sump and a 40g frag tank. has been running for a little over a year without issue.
Salinity 1.026
ammonia 0
nitrite 0
nitrate 1

has anyone experienced this? ive never had a fish that couldnt catch food it was interested in eating. thanks
 
I've had this happen to fish going blind several times. You either have to start target feeding or figure out some other method to provide "special care"; or the fish slowly starves to death. This also applies to fish suffering from swim bladder disorder.
